This guide shows you how to play the games on any 21/9 or larger ultra-wide aspect proportions without the bar on the side.
The perquisites
You will require the following items to play Ultrawide.
- A Computer
- Dave the Diver
- Borderless Gaming
Downloading the Borderless Gaming App
To complete this step, go to Borderless Gaming Github to download the latest application release. ( If you like, you can visit Borderless Gaming Steam Version on [steampowered.com]
You can support the developer by purchasing directly from Steam. )
Scroll down a bit until you find Borderless Gaming Version X.X.X. You’ll find it on the page where you can download it.
Once the.exe has finished downloading launch it and continue to install it. You NEED administrative rights to install the software!
You can choose where to install this file or keep it on the default location. The rest of the installation process is the same.
Once the installation process is complete, you may move on to step 2 of the user guide.
Borderless Gaming
Once you’ve opened Borderless Gaming, you’ll notice this small window. Dave the Diver must already be running before it appears in Borderless Gaming.
Select DAVE The Diver, then click on the arrow icon pointing right of the screen to add to your favorites.
Click the right box and select “Check” to confirm your selection. Full Screen with Auto-Maximize
Dave the Diver – Setting up
Click on the game to access the settings in the main menu of the game or its phone settings.
Once you are in the game’s settings, select Resolution. This will change your aspect ratio from 16:9 to 16A09556986A. Borderless Gaming (i.e. 1925×1080 > 1920×1080, 3440×1440>2560×1440), should now have applied everything. You should now be able to see more on both sides of the screen.
For those with problems with the game stretching out rather than unlocking a side, you can go to Borderless Gaming. You will see an icon with a rectangle with arrows pointing upwards*

Known Issues
I’ve encountered some minor bugs and issues playing on the 21:9 ratio.
- UI stays 16 x 9
- Textures, UI, and other elements that are not meant to show on the edges of your screen.
- When working in a café, the UI is not centered.
- Cutscene is only available in 16:9 format.
As of the moment I am writing this, there have been no game-breaking issues.
The only thing that can be annoying until you figure it out is that when working at a restaurant, the UI prompts will not be in the center. This can be worked around by aiming at the prompt on the customer’s screen. When I get the opportunity, I’ll upload an example screenshot.
